  • House fails to override Biden's first veto March 23, 2023
    The Republican-led House on Thursday failed to override President Biden’s first veto, falling short of the two-thirds majority needed to revive the resolution targeting an administration rule related to ESG investing, which takes environmental and social factors into account. The chamber voted 219-200, with Rep. Jared Golden (D-Maine) voting with every Republican in favor of...
